45 CFR 1149.44: What must documents filed with the ALJ include?

(a) Documents filed with the ALJ must include:

(1) An original; and

(2) Two copies.

(b) Every document filed in the proceeding must contain:

(1) A title, for example, “motion to quash subpoena”;

(2) A caption setting forth the title of the action; and

(3) The case number assigned by the ALJ.

(c) Every document must be signed by the filer, or his/her representative, and contain the address or telephone number of that person.
